Copper Proteinate in Dog Food
What is Copper Proteinate?
Copper proteinate is a compound formed by the chelation of copper
with proteins or amino acids. This form improves the
bioavailability of copper, making it easier for dogs to absorb and
utilize.
Benefits of Copper Proteinate:
Enhanced Absorption: The chelation process helps increase the
absorption rate of copper compared to inorganic forms, which can be
less bioavailable.
Supports Healthy Coat:
Copper plays a crucial role in melanin production, which
contributes to coat color and health.
Bone Health: Copper is essential for the development and
maintenance of connective tissues and bones.
Immune Function: Adequate copper levels support immune system
function, helping dogs resist infections.
Antioxidant Activity: Copper is involved in enzymatic processes
that protect cells from oxidative stress.

What is copper proteinate used for?
Benefits: Copper proteinate is a highly bioavailable source of
copper, which is essential for many bodily functions in dogs.
Issues: Over-supplementation of copper can lead to toxicity and
liver damage in dogs. Copper proteinate may not be suitable for
dogs with copper storage disease.
Copper can affect the normal development of various tissues and
organs of the
animal body, and has a great impact on hematopoiesis, coat color,
central nervous
system, reproductive function, etc. Copper can improve the level of
animal
humoral immunity and cellular immunity; Copper is involved in the
formation of
bone and is of great significance for the formation of elastin in
bone cells and
colloid. Phytate, ascorbic acid, zinc, iron, lead, sulfur,
molybdenum, etc. in the diet
all affect the absorption of copper ions. Experiments have proved
that the
molecular structure of amino acid chelated copper is similar to the
natural form
of copper in organisms, which can be quickly absorbed and utilized
by animal
intestines, and is higher bioavailable than inorganic copper.

3. Recommended dosage:
Feeding objects | Recommended dosage |
pig | Add 30 ~ 60g of this product per ton of complete feed |
Birds | Add 10 ~ 100g of this product per ton of complete feed |
cattle | Add 100g of this product per ton of complete feed |
sheep | Add 70~100g of this product per ton of complete feed |
Fish | Add 30~60g of this product per ton of complete feed |
Flexible use according to biological varieties, growth period and
other factors There were
no adverse effects
